LIHEAP Applications Now Being Accepted The application period for the Low-Income Home Energy Assistance Program (LIHEAP) is now open with eligibility expanded from 150 percent to approximately 210 percent of the federal poverty income guidelines to help low income people pay their heating bills.

CDC Expands Coughing Recommendations If a cold or flu finds you coughing, the U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) is recommending covering your mouth and nose with a tissue when you cough or sneeze and immediately disposing of the used tissue. However, when a tissue is not at hand, the CDC recommends you cough or sneeze into your upper sleeve and elbow.

Flu Vaccine Clinic Locator Now Available The Pennsylvania Department of Aging (PDA) is issuing a reminder to those over age 65 to locate a flu vaccine clinic before the holidays move into full swing increasing possible exposure to the influenza virus. Those who are frail or have other health problems are particularly susceptible to dying from the flu or a related illness like pneumonia and are considered high risk, according to the PDA.

Senate Republicans today elected Sen. Jake Corman (R-34) to serve as Chairman of the Senate Appropriations Committee for the 2009-10 Legislative Session. The Appropriations Committee reviews all legislation for its fiscal impact and plays a crucial role in developing the state budget.
